Output ec5293c366b8eca49dc6427c071dde0b9db707c09568493648c7d66157086a28:0

value
28949260
script pubkey
OP_0 OP_PUSHBYTES_20 13eac7ec280ea0bef6d1076d79972ea7ae683ea1
address
ltc1qz04v0mpgp6staak3qakhn9ew57hxs04plktl3c
transaction
ec5293c366b8eca49dc6427c071dde0b9db707c09568493648c7d66157086a28
spent
true